Punctuate this sentence. yes I heard Mr Brown calling Josh

Yes, I heard Mr. Brown calling Josh.

You would use a comma after "yes", a period after "Mr" and another period to finish the sentence.

What evidence from Gilgamesh: A New English Version best supports the conclusion that Gilgamesh is an epic hero? Select 3 option
defon

Answer:

Gilgamesh said, "courage, dear brother, / this is no time to give in to fear."

Gilgamesh felt his courage return. / they charged at Humbaba like two wild bulls.

He yelled, he lifted / his massive axe, he swung it, it tore / into Humbaba's neck

Explanation:

An epic hero is the main protagonist of a story that is usually on a quest and has supernatural help from gods, or deities or even has extraordinary abilities of his own which help him achieve his quest.

Gilgamesh is a good example of an epic hero because he has help from Enkidu in defeating Humbaba.

The lines that show characteristics of an epic hero is enormous courage and composure, loyalty, physical strength, etc.
